저기 div 중앙으로 징집하는거 저 나름대로 생각한건데.. 정보
저기 div 중앙으로 징집하는거 저 나름대로 생각한건데..본문
Div 소스에서요 . 중앙으로 강제 징집하는거 있잖아요
보통...
margin 0 auto;
를 많이쓰잖아요.. 그런데 이것보다 갑자기 떠오른건데..
left 값을 50% 로 지정하면 중앙으로 배열되지 않을까요.. 그냥 .. 써봅니다.
될지 않될지는 안해보았습니다. ^^
되면... 혁명인가? 아닌가 이미 쓰고있나.. 흐엉. .쓰고있겠지요..
추천
0
0
댓글 16개
body 에 주신거에요?
left:50%;
하신다음에 div 의 width값의 절반을 계산하여 margin-left:-절반값px; 하시면 중앙정렬 되요.
그렇지만 전 margin:0 auto; 쓰고 있습니다
하신다음에 div 의 width값의 절반을 계산하여 margin-left:-절반값px; 하시면 중앙정렬 되요.
그렇지만 전 margin:0 auto; 쓰고 있습니다
body { text-align:center; } 이렇게만 해도 정렬이 되던데
그런데 margin:0 auto; 이거는 익스 6에서는 body 에 줬는데 정렬이 않되네요
그런데 margin:0 auto; 이거는 익스 6에서는 body 에 줬는데 정렬이 않되네요

그건 글꼴이 center정렬됩니다^^;;; 텍스트속성이기때문에^^;;
위에서 말하는건 div 자체^^;;
위에서 말하는건 div 자체^^;;
body { text-align:center; }
이게 텍스트 속성이긴 한데 div 나 table 등 가운데 정렬이 같이 되요
이게 텍스트 속성이긴 한데 div 나 table 등 가운데 정렬이 같이 되요

dtd선언하면 안먹는걸로 알고있는데....
선언후에도 되나요?
선언후에도 되나요?
div 는 ....레이어의 개념으로 다가가야해서.. 정렬이 되지 않을걸요 ... div 는 그 한개 한개마다 값이 다른걸로 알고있는데.. ㅅㅅ

익스6에서 margin: 0 auto; 속성이 적용되려면 DTD 선언은 필수입니다.
아 그런가요? 한번 해봐야 겠네요
body에 쓰는게 아니라 margin:0 auto는 div style에 바로 써주면 잘 적용되요.
그리고 dtd 선언후에 text-align:center; 을 주게되면 body의 하위 객체들에 들어간 이미지나 텍스트 등이 모두 다 가운데 정렬되요. 그러니까 예를들면.. 테이블에서 왼쪽정렬 되야할 텍스트단락이 가운데정렬로 되버려서, 차라리 table align="center" 혹은 div style="margin:0 auto;" 이런식으로 주는게 훨씬 좋아요..
그리고 dtd 선언후에 text-align:center; 을 주게되면 body의 하위 객체들에 들어간 이미지나 텍스트 등이 모두 다 가운데 정렬되요. 그러니까 예를들면.. 테이블에서 왼쪽정렬 되야할 텍스트단락이 가운데정렬로 되버려서, 차라리 table align="center" 혹은 div style="margin:0 auto;" 이런식으로 주는게 훨씬 좋아요..
<div style='margin:0px auto;'></div>
이 소스가 익스 6에서도 정렬 되나요?
이 소스가 익스 6에서도 정렬 되나요?

dtd 선언하면 됩니다.
단 해당 오브젝트에 width 값이 있어야합니다.
단 해당 오브젝트에 width 값이 있어야합니다.
아 그런가요?? 한번 해봐야 겠네요
text-align 은 파폭이나 타 브라우저에선 악먹힙니다.
_text-align을 이용하세요
_text-align을 이용하세요

body{_text-align:center;} 이렇게 되야 겠죠 ..^^;;
<center>레이어</center>